    Hello Sir,

    Could you please explain why ”right of use asset” contains the amount of the initial measurement of the lease liability?

    Thank you.

    Start of lease – decide what you are paying in present value terms

    Then Dr Right of Use Asset Cr Lease liability with that amount.

    The liability is fairly stated and we have show the asset at something!

    So we use the same figure as the liability

    You may find it useful to refresh your lessee accounting using our FR lecture – the SBR lecture is more about lessor and sale and leaseback

    Okay.. Sir, my question is that why is liability a part of right of use asset? I don’t understand the logic behind liability being part of an asset cost, please?

    You have to measure the asset at something. Cost means the money that we have paid and will have to pay. So we use the related liability.

    No different to buying any asset on credit.
